Login archlinux

I don't know how to login to root account. It's the first time I setup Archlinux on VirtualBox

Re: Login archlinux

If you haven't set a root password, then it should be empty. root enter enter?

Alternatively, boot the installer, arch-chroot into your installation (see the installation guide for mounting and things like that) and set a root password according to 3.7 of the installation guide.

Re: Login archlinux

Awebb wrote:

If you haven't set a root password, then it should be empty.

Nope. The default root password is an invalid one, see https://github.com/archlinux/svntogit-p … ab1705185b.

https://wiki.archlinux.org/title/Reset_ … t_password lists multiple ways to change the root password.
